    Concerto grosso works were antiphonal – i.e. a small group of strings (called a concertino) alternated playing with a larger group (called the ripieno). The music played by the concertino often contrasted with the sections played by the ripieno. The Solo Concerto. The solo concerto is a concerto for individual player and orchestra.

  4. A concerto is a piece of classical music that features a soloist accompanied by an orchestra. The soloist stands or sits at the front of the stage near the conductor so that they can be seen and heard clearly. Concertos are usually very difficult for the soloist and require technical and expressive expertise.
